Our Point-to-Point (PTP) 300 Series Wireless Ethernet Bridges operate in the 5.4 and 5.8 GHz license-exempt bands at Ethernet data rates up to 25 Mbps and distances up to 155 miles (250 km). The systems are engineered to reliably transport your communications in virtually any environment, including: non-line-of-sight (NLOS), long-range line-of-sight (LOS) and high interference environments, as well as over water and desert terrain. With a PTP 300 solution, you can establish communications in areas that were previously considered un-connectable.
